Music
 
Undergraduate Programs

The City College of New York offers the following undergraduate degrees:
Bachelor of Arts (B.A.)

Bachelor of Fine Arts (B.F.A.)
  • Classical Instrumental Performance
  • Classical Vocal Performance
  • Jazz Instrumental Performance
  • Jazz Vocal Performance
  • Music & Audio Technology (Sonic Arts)

Specialization programs, designed with the help of an adviser, meet the needs of each student’s post-collegiate objectives. Free electives should be chosen not only as a supplement to the specialization program but also as an opportunity to pursue other interests and to broaden intellectual perspectives.


MUSIC EDUCATION

Those interested in music education should be aware that teacher certification in New York State requires the completion of a music major degree (B.A. or B.F.A.) and a music education minor.

  THE MUSIC MAJOR   
  Students who have successfully passed, or been exempted from,
  Music 13100 (Elementary Musicianship) may file a Major Declaration
  Form and propose themselves as candidates for the B.A. degree
  (code 145) or B.F.A. degree (code 119).
